    Abstract: After first installation of an application program on a computing device, the computing devices monitors a behavior of the application program for a period of time and then builds a behavior profile of the application program from the behavior. After the period of time has elapsed, such as specified period of time, the computing device may prevent the application program from deviating from the behavior profile. After the period of time has elapsed, such as when an update or patch to the application program has been applied or installed, the computing device may continue to monitor the behavior of the application program, and in response to determining that the behavior of the application program after the period of time deviates from the behavior profile, perform an action with respect to the application program.

    Abstract: An apparatus can include an interface; cache memory; a plurality of drives; and a controller that includes detection circuitry, a write through mode and a write back mode, where the write through mode writes information received via the interface to the plurality of drives, where the write back mode writes information received via the interface to the cache memory and writes information written to the cache memory to the plurality of drives, and where the detection circuitry selects the write through mode based at least in part on detection of a first condition and selects the write back mode based at least in part on detection of a second condition, where the first condition and the second condition differ.

    Abstract: An amount of a hardware resource is assigned to a virtual machine (VM) to be run on a computing device including the hardware resource. The VM is caused to run on the computing device, and usage of the hardware resource by the VM is monitor. In response to determining that the usage of the hardware resource by the VM is less than a threshold, the amount of the hardware resource assigned to the VM is decreased.

    Abstract: A faucet mounting system includes an upper fixture including an outer wall defining a chamber, and at least one groove formed within an inner surface of the outer wall. A lower mounting shank extends below the upper fixture and includes a skirt, a post extending downwardly from the skirt, and at least one spring clip. The at least one spring clip is recessed within an outer surface of the skirt in a compressed position, and extending outside of the outer surface of the skirt in an extended position.

    Abstract: For providing granular quality of service (QoS) for computing resources in a computing system, systems, apparatus, and methods are disclosed. The apparatus includes a processor having a plurality of processor cores and a memory that stores code executable by the processor to identify a thread belonging to a computing process, to identify one or more thread-level tags associated with the thread, to determine a computational requirement of the thread based on the one or more thread-level tags, and to assign the thread to one of the processor cores based on the computational requirement. In certain embodiments, the may include code executable by the processor to allocate hardware resources to the thread based on an intra-process priority, the hardware resources being allocated from a set of hardware resources assigned to the computing process.
